Compare all specifications:
2007 Alpina B3 | 1998 Toyota Camry | |
Make | Alpina | Toyota |
Model | B3 | Camry |
Year Released | 2007 | 1998 |
Body Type | Sedan |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3001 cc | 2164 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 360 HP | 135 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 5400 RPM |
Torque | 501 Nm | 196 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3800 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1810 mm |
